East Kent Goldings Whole Leaf Hops
East Kent Goldings hops are a classic UK aroma variety prized for their refined, gentle character and heritage pedigree.
Known for soft floral, honey, and earthy notes, EKG hops contribute a smooth, delicate aroma that complements malt-forward recipes.
Best used in late boil additions or the whirlpool to preserve their subtle aromatic qualities.
East Kent Goldings Hop Profile
- Origin: United Kingdom (East Kent)
- Alpha Acid: 4–6%
- Beta Acid: 2–3%
- Characteristics: Floral, earthy, honey, mild spice
- Substitutes: Goldings, Styrian Golding, Fuggle
- Use: Aroma, late boil, whirlpool
East Kent Goldings Hop Flavour
EKG offers a soft, traditional hop aroma that blends effortlessly into British-style beers.
Expect a gentle floral bouquet with underlying earthy-sweet tones, especially when used in late additions.
Beer Styles for East Kent Goldings Hops
East Kent Goldings are ideal for traditional UK styles where hop aroma plays a supportive, elegant role.
- English Bitter: Delivers classic floral character with low bitterness impact.
- ESB: Rounds out rich malt with subtle honeyed top notes.
- English Mild: Adds gentle spice and earthiness without overpowering.
- Porter: Layers soft herbal tones under dark grain character.
- English Golden Ale: Provides balance with clean, floral lift.
East Kent Goldings Hop Substitutes
East Kent Goldings hops can be substituted with other mild UK aroma varieties such as Goldings, Styrian Golding, or Fuggle.
- Goldings: Very close in profile, though lacking the distinct terroir of the East Kent region.
- Styrian Golding: Similar aroma with slightly more herbal character and European nuance.
- Fuggle: More earthy and less floral, but fills a similar role in traditional British ales.
East Kent Goldings Hop Pairings
Pairs well with hops like Fuggle, Challenger, and Northdown for building classic British-style aroma layers.
- Fuggle: Deepens the earthy and herbal character in darker styles.
- Challenger: Adds subtle bitterness and soft spice to round out aroma.
- Northdown: Blends in mild resin and floral tones for added depth.
Brewer’s Tip
Use EKG in the final 10 minutes or whirlpool to protect its delicate aroma.
It's not meant to shine alone — think of it as a background harmony in malt-forward English styles.
